Transaction 6879f7beaecc873781740788830bb93263261bfdbd57e99c1d798b509712357b

2 Input
2 Outputs
  • 6879f7beaecc873781740788830bb93263261bfdbd57e99c1d798b509712357b:0
  • value  134970
    address  1577Pg5AoenhSJWG5kBHjCVpVPeepiD2p2
  • 6879f7beaecc873781740788830bb93263261bfdbd57e99c1d798b509712357b:1
  • value  1056149
    address  3JDjxvc8Q9ppc2TFx29UYjp9rGu3SQgtVW